[Hudson Herald, Hudson, Iowa, Thursday, October 8, 1981]

Arthur Cragle Dies from Accident Injuries Friday.

Funeral services for Arthur L. Cragle, 48, of 101 Stacey Circle, were held Tuesday, October 6, 1981, at 1:00 p.m., at Grace Baptist Church, Waterloo. Burial will be in Oakdale Cemetery, Hunlock Creek, Pennsylvania with Kearns-Dykeman Chapel in charge of services.

Mr. Cragle passed away Friday night at Schoitz Hospital as a result of injuries he suffered in a motorcycle-truck accident at 2:30 p.m. Friday.

Cragle, traveling north on Highway 63, attempted to make a left turn from the highway onto Waterloo Road at the intersection near Keith Motors. A semi-truck driven by Duane Kelly of Westville, Oklahoma, started to pass the vehicle at the same time and hit the cycle broadside.

He was born January 21, 1933, at Hunlock Creek, Pennsylvania, the son of Orval and Mildred Briggs Cragle. He was married to Lenore Whitesell on June 26, 1954 at Sweet Valley, Pennsylvania.

He was employed as an inspector at Waterloo John Deere and also owned Art Cragle Realty, Hudson. They have lived in Hudson since 1974.

He served in the Air Force during the Korean War. He was a 1960 graduate of San Jose, California.

Survivors include his wife; his parents; four sons, David R., at home, Stephen P. of St. Paul, Minnesota, Scott A. of Ames and Jonathon L. at home; two brothers, Alvin of Lehman, Pennsylvania and Orval Jr., of Benson, Arizona; one sister, Cora Hoagland of Hunlock Creek, Pennsylvania.
